收藏本站 | 论文目录

关键词: python matlab plc 单片机 dsp fpga 仿真 stm32

当前位置: 毕业论文设计参考 >> 电子电气通信 >> 通信工程本科论文

TD-SCDMA网络Iub接口FP层的信令解码

[关键词:TD-SCDMA,Iub接口,信令解码]  [热度 ]
提示:此毕业设计论文完整版包含【论文
作品编号:txgc0090,word全文:58页,合计:21000

以下仅为该作品极少介绍,详细内容请点击购买完整版!
TD-SCDMA网络Iub接口FP层的信令解码毕业设计论文------

模块功能

数据采集模块,如图3.2,连接待测试的TD-SCDMA系统的Iu、Iub、Iur等接口上,采集被测接口物理层的信令消息。

协议解码模块,解码是整个系统的基础。解码可以分成很多细小的解码模块,能提供消息特征参数的提取、消息简单解码、消息详细解码的功能;呼叫合成模,把消息按呼叫归类,并根据该消息,增加或者是修改呼叫状态。该模块要调用解码模块;统计分析模块,通过消息统计分析动态链接库对数据采集模块中的消息按照协议类别和消息类型进行分类统计;消息过滤模块,根据TD-SCDMA系统中Iu、Iub和Iur接口协议的特点为AAL2 (ATM Adaptation Layertype2,ATM适配层2)、AAL5(ATMAdaptation Layertype 5,ATM适配层5)、网络控制层和无线网络层提供消息过滤功能;主控模块,控制和调用其他功能部件,从数据采集接口读取信令消息、管理消息数据、显示消息解码结果及统计分析结果,并完成程序中线程的调度。

上述几个模块中,主控模块是主动的,其他几个模块是被动的。主控模块根据从硬件读取的数据和用户的操作请求,调用其他功能模块,得到结果后,把结果显示给用户。各个功能模块不负责与用户界面有关的任何操作。各个功能模块只是简单的接受主控模块提供的参数,经过处理,把运算结果返回给主控程序,主控程序再把结果显示给用户。

1、数据采集模块

连接在TD-SCDMA系统的Iu、Iub和Iur接口上,采集接口中的信令消息,并完成信元的定界、拆分与重组,采集的消息经处理后放在“原始消息”的缓冲区。本模块部件中的数据采集卡通过PCI总线与工控机连接相互交互数据,通信缓冲区利用双口RAM实现,在接口之间建立一个较大容量的缓冲区,均可以在任何时候向双口RAM的任一存储单元读写数据,不需相互等待。

2、协议解码模块

具体包括Iur、Iu、Iub接口消息解码模块。通过调用解码函数对接收到的消息解码。解码函数写在动态链接库中,各动态链接库函数编写完成后,解码模块中的各个动态链接库共同合成消息解码模块,通过主控程序调用此动态链接库达到解码功能,消息数据解码包括简单解码和详细解码。采用动态链接库的方式,不涉及具体的程序界面的编写,这样有利于程序各个模块之间的松耦合。

3、消息统计分析模块

提供网络控制层和无线网络层各协议类别和消息分类统计,完成各种统计结果的分析功能,为网络优化提供决策参考。通过消息统计分析动态链接库对数据采集模块中的信令数据按照AAL类型、协议类别和消息类型进行分类统计,统计用户关心的参数。

4、数据后台存储模块

把采集到的消息数据存储到磁盘上。将统计分析的结果、每条消息的详细解码结果转化为文本文件进行保存,信令数据转化为.dat文件进行保存,便于形成日后的使用记录和进行历史数据分析。

5、消息过滤处理模块

针对TD-SCDMA移动通信网lu、Iub和Iur接口协议栈的特点,对AAL2、AAL5、传输网络层和无线网络层提供的消息进行过滤,包含分层显示过滤、项目显示过滤、通道显示过滤等。分层显示过滤是指过滤出用户关心的那一层协议和消息;项目显示过滤是指显示符合某些条件的消息或者参数;通道显示指的是只显示某一或某些通道的消息解码。这样,既可以查看某一特定类型的消息,还可以让解码显示窗口只显示某种类型或仅含某种成分的消息。

本文所做的工作是网络监测仪软件部分的解码模块。本文结合网络监测仪,总体结构和功能,重点介绍了解码模块实现的思路,详细分析了业务分析模块实现的目标,方案的设计,接口的定义,解码模块的具体实现过程和最后达到的结果并且结合少量数据对该模块进行了测试,为模块在整个监测中作用做验证。

 

 


以上仅为该作品极少介绍,详细内容请点击购买完整版!

提示:此毕业设计论文完整版包含【论文
作品编号:txgc0090,word全文:58页,合计:21000

本通信工程毕业设计论文作品由 毕业论文设计参考 [http://www.qflunwen.com] 征集整理——TD-SCDMA网络Iub接口FP层的信令解码(论文)!